    9:00X16 tire Availability

    Lucas Classic Tires has them. They are running at $209 (+ shipping?), made by Speedway. Summit Racing also has them. They are running at $287 with free shipping and are marked Firestone from Coker tires.

    Whats this called?

    Pg 178 of the ORD 9 TM (1955 dtd) lists it as the "Receptacle, radio, 24-V, waterproof, with cable, assy" and lists each component of the assembly. I've seen these sold as a whole unit on ebay every once in a while though I suppose if you have the connector, you can rebuild the rest back to...
